Aleit Takes a Trip Down Wedding Memory Lane - Part 11

Today we think back to Karin and Richard’s very off-beat and “rainy” urban wedding day in Cape Town. 

The ceremony and first part of the pre-dinner drinks were hosted at the foot of Table Mountain in the pouring rain (underneath a much appreciated Bedouin Tent!).  The wet weather did not dampen this gorgeous couple’s and their guests’ spirits as they were ushered with giant white rain umbrellas from their cars to the ceremony area!

Then moving to Pigalle Restaurant in Green Point for a cocktail and bubbly welcome in the foyer.  The Aleit Team transformed the restaurant to seat 150 guests at long tables… The ambience was elegant, edgy and chic.  We will never forget the a la carte service – each guest received their chosen dish cooked to perfection according to their specifications.  Combine that with exquisite service, a live swing band and an authentic cigar bar and you have a winning recipe for an unforgettable celebration!

Ps Karin and Richard’s opening dance was choreographed by our very own dance expert, Hayley!
